2. Editing and Creating Pages
Ready to share your expertise? Follow these steps:
- Account Creation: Register for a wiki account. This is usually a simple process requiring a username and password.
- Familiarize Yourself with Guidelines: Before making significant edits, review the wiki's editing guidelines. These ensure consistency in formatting, tone, and content. Look for a link to "Wiki Guidelines" or "Style Guide" in the footer or sidebar.
- Find a Page to Edit: Look for pages that are incomplete, have outdated information, or are missing entirely.
- Use the Edit Button: On any page you wish to edit, click the "Edit" button (usually at the top). This will open a rich text editor.
- Make Your Changes:
- Text: Directly edit the text.
- Formatting: Use the provided tools for headings, bold text, italics, lists, and links.
- Tables: For item lists, enemy stats, or comparison charts, use the table creation tool.
- Images: Upload relevant screenshots or artwork (ensure they are properly licensed or your own).
- Summarize Your Changes: In the "Edit Summary" box, briefly describe what you changed (e.g., "Added boss weaknesses," "Corrected item drop rate," "Expanded lore section").
- Preview and Save: Always use the "Preview" button to see how your changes will look before saving. Once satisfied, click "Save Page."
- Creating New Pages: If a topic doesn't have a page yet, you can create one by typing the desired page title into the search bar and clicking "Create page." Ensure your content adheres to wiki standards.
